Handover: Larkspit gateway rate limiting. I moved the per-tenant limits from static config to the quota service; token buckets refill every 10s now. One known gap — burst headroom isn't enforced on the batch endpoints yet. Tomas picks this up next sprint. Current limits and override process are documented here:

operations page: https://jenkins.zemvarcloud.local/job/merge_requests/repo/build/73930b4b30f0a8ed

## Ticket: Config drift — dark mode on admin dashboard

Several Hollowfen admin dashboard tenants show broken dark-mode styling after last week's deploy. Root cause: theme settings drifted between the canary and stable pools — canary got the new token set, stable didn't. Support: don't advise users to clear cache; it won't help. Fix is to reconcile the theme config across both pools and redeploy the dashboard shell. For reference, the stable pool should match the following configuration values:

settings of kagup-tagug:
ULAIX_HOST=ulaix.zemvarsys.internal
ULAIX_PORT=8000

## Transcode Farm: Restarting a Stuck Worker

Welcome to the Pixelbarn farm! If a worker node on the Glimmer cluster stops pulling jobs, first check whether its scratch disk filled up — that's the cause nine times out of ten. Drain the node, clear the scratch partition, and re-enroll it via the farmctl tool. Jobs will resume from their last checkpointed segment, so nothing is lost. When filing the incident note, include the token shown below.

build token for kagaf-hahof: htk14_9d3d4d26d7d8de

Subject: RateLens cut-over complete

Hi Priya,

Welcome aboard. Over the weekend we moved RateLens, our hotel rate-parity checker, from the old Vantry cluster to the new Orvane environment. All scraper queues drained cleanly, and the comparison jobs for the Calderon Suites pilot ran without errors this morning. Alerting thresholds were re-tuned, so expect fewer false positives. Please verify your local setup against the production settings before touching anything. The current configuration values are as follows.

deployment values, tajep-fahag:
ulaath:
  pin: 7600
  metrics_host: metrics.ulaath.zemvarlabs.internal
  tenant: drueth
  seal: seal_5c905fe9